What is working for CVS?

After CVS went inside the Target stores, they closed their standalone CVS stores near by. Here is why they did that.

Being inside Target, they did not have to worry about retailing greeting cards every two miles. Business of selling toilet paper, kitchen towels, batteries, and laundry detergent was taken by Amazon and whey are bringing it to the customer’s door step. Beauty was taken by Ulta and Sephora in recent years. The only thing that was left was cigarettes, candy, milk, useless technology, and some office supplies. They thought keeping full store every two miles did not make sense. So when the opportunity came to take target’s pharmacy space they jumped on it. Traffic was already brought in by Target.

Walgreens needs to do same. We need to be inside Kohls along with Sephora and Amazon Returns. Get their traffic and boost pharmacy.

Greeting card is good business but not every two miles and same goes for other items.

We can also print beauty coupons if they are shopping in Kohl’s and probably Sephora. Kohl’s does that when someone returns at Amazon desk.
